DOUBLE-SIDED PRESENTATION QUILT made from Pacific Northwest Wool.

48" X 64" -  Soft wool patches in many colors from the Portland (Oregon) Woolen Mills. The patches were remnants from woolen skirts and blazers made by the Western Star Manufacturing Company of Seattle, c.a. 1960. The double-sided construction is rare and provides extra warmth.

The quilt was designed and stitched by Western Star’s senior seamstresses. The finished quilt was presented to William McColloch, the company’s owner, upon his retirement in 1970. His son John was at Henderson Camp in the late 1950’s, and his granddaughters, Elizabeth and Jenny, attended Camp Nor'wester, first on Sperry and then Johns Island. The camp experience of father and daughters collectively spanned 28 seasons.
